Portable and compact

A treadmill that folds up is a practical option for people looking to exercise at home. They are easy to store when not in use, unlike models that do not fold. Simply fold them up to free up space. They also have more compact dimensions, making them ideal for smaller spaces.

There are some disadvantages to folding treadmills. While they make it easier to include fitness into your routine, you should also take into consideration the drawbacks. They could require more frequent maintenance and repairs because they are folded and unfolded frequently. This can result in a decrease in structural stability, performance and life span.

Folding treadmills can also be an issue due to the shorter stride and absence of incline adjustment. These limitations could affect the user's natural walking and running style, which could lead to injuries over time. They can cause difficulty for the user to maintain proper body posture, which can cause stress on joints and back.

Another important thing to consider is how much maintenance a treadmill that folds require. These models are usually designed for portability and space-saving, therefore they're less sophisticated than models that don't fold. This means that they are more likely to be subject to wear and tear than other types of treadmills so make sure to review reviews and carefully compare specifications before making a purchase.

The majority of the top treadmills that fold are able to maintain a steady running speed of up to 10 or 12 mph. They are perfect for those who wish to maintain their fitness while on the move. It's best to check the treadmill's continuous HP (CHP) rating. This is the metric that indicates how well it can keep up with your jogging or running.

The size of the treadmill belt is important. Some folding treadmills are able to accommodate a Small Treadmill Incline amount of running space, which can be a problem for people who use their treadmill for longer exercise sessions or long runs. In this instance it's a good idea to pay more for a larger model that can offer the comfort you require to be able to enjoy your workout.
